asm: add initial infrastructure for an external assembler
This change adds some initial logic implementing an external assembler for Cranelift's x64 backend, as proposed in RFC [bytecodealliance#41]. This adds two crates: - the `cranelift/assembler/meta` crate defines the instructions; to print out the defined instructions use `cargo run -p cranelift-assembler-meta` - the `cranelift/assembler` crate exposes the generated Rust code for those instructions; to see the path to the generated code use `cargo run -p cranelift-assembler` The assembler itself is straight-forward enough (module the code generation, of course); its integration into `cranelift-codegen` is what is most tricky about this change. Instructions that we will emit in the new assembler are contained in the `Inst::External` variant. This unfortunately increases the memory size of `Inst`, but only temporarily if we end up removing the extra `enum` indirection by adopting the new assembler wholesale. Another integration point is ISLE: we generate ISLE definitions and a Rust helper macro to make the external assembler instructions accessible to ISLE lowering. This change introduces some duplication: the encoding logic (e.g. for REX instructions) currently lives both in `cranelift-codegen` and the new assembler crate. The `Formatter` logic for the assembler `meta` crate is quite similar to the other `meta` crate. This minimal duplication felt worth the additional safety provided by the new assembler. The `cranelift-assembler` crate is fuzzable (see the `README.md`). It will generate instructions with randomized operands and compare their encoding and pretty-printed string to a known-good disassembler, currently `capstone`. This gives us confidence we previously didn't have regarding emission. In the future, we may want to think through how to fuzz (or otherwise check) the integration between `cranelift-codegen` and this new assembler level. [bytecodealliance#41]: bytecodealliance/rfcs#41

# `cranelift-assembler-x64` | ||
|
||
A Cranelift-specific x64 assembler. Unlike the existing `cranelift-codegen` | ||
assembler, this assembler uses instructions, not instruction classes, as the | ||
core abstraction. | ||
|
||
### Use | ||
|
||
Like `cranelift-codegen`, using this assembler starts with `enum Inst`. For | ||
convenience, a `main.rs` script prints the path to this generated code: | ||
|
||
```console | ||
$ cat $(cargo run) | ||
#[derive(arbitrary::Arbitrary, Debug)] | ||
pub enum Inst { | ||
andb_i(andb_i), | ||
andw_i(andw_i), | ||
andl_i(andl_i), | ||
... | ||
``` | ||
|
||
### Test | ||
|
||
In order to check that this assembler emits correct machine code, we fuzz it | ||
against a known-good disassembler. We can run a quick, one-second check: | ||
|
||
```console | ||
$ cargo test -- --nocapture | ||
``` | ||
|
||
Or we can run the fuzzer indefinitely: | ||
|
||
```console | ||
$ cargo +nightly fuzz run -s none roundtrip -j16 | ||
``` | ||
